HORSE FALLS ON RIDER.

MAORI SERIOUSLY HURT. [BY TELEGRAPH. —OWN CORRESPONDENT. ] HAMILTON. Thursday, A®Maori named Kepa, of Puohue, near To Awamutu, was admitted to the Wai kato Hospital to-day suffering from a fraoture of the shoulder-blade. He was breaking-in a horsa when it fell on him.
